Picture a place where vintage guitars dangle from every inch of the ceiling alongside kitschy lunch boxes, old Florida memorabilia, and quirky signage that tells stories of decades past.

Dixie Grill & Brewery stands as one of the most uniquely decorated restaurants in all of Florida, where antiques and collectibles create an atmosphere that’s part hunting lodge, part nostalgic dive bar, and completely unforgettable.

This local brewpub has been perfecting its craft since 2004, evolving into one of the very few true brewpubs in all of South Florida.

What sets Dixie apart isn’t just its eclectic décor – it’s the combination of scratch-made food, house-brewed craft beers, and the kind of neighborhood charm that keeps locals coming back week after week.

Built to be a neighborhood restaurant attracting locals from all around South Florida, this place truly has something for everyone. You’ll find yourself in an intimate setting with just about 16 tables, where the buzz of conversation mingles with the clinking of craft beer glasses and the sizzle of half-pound burgers hitting the grill.

Menu Highlights & House Specialties

The Legendary Beer Cheese Dip: This signature starter is absolutely perfect pub food where you can really taste the hoppiness of the beer they use to make the dip. Served piping hot with soft pretzels, it’s the kind of appetizer that converts first-time visitors into regulars. The rich, creamy texture combined with that distinctive beer flavor makes it an essential start to any meal here.

Half-Pound Hand-Pattied Burgers: These aren’t your typical frozen patties – every burger is hand-formed and cooked to order, creating massive, satisfying meals that draw raves from customers.

Popular choices include the Black and Blue Burger, the Dixie Pub Burger, the Fire Burger, and the Texas Burger, all served with crispy fries that perfectly complement the juicy patties. These burgers are substantial enough to satisfy even the heartiest appetites.

Wings Done Right: Whether you prefer them grilled or fried, the wings here are another standout specialty that keeps drawing customers back. The buffalo chicken sandwich also gets high marks from regular visitors who appreciate the quality and flavor. You’ll taste the difference that comes from a scratch kitchen that takes pride in every order.

Fresh Seafood Options: The catfish comes highly recommended by repeat visitors, while the Mahi-Mahi sandwich offers a lighter alternative to the hearty burger selection.

The pulled pork gets praise too, especially when paired with the tangy BBQ sauce served on the side. Even more adventurous diners can try the gator tail, which tastes remarkably similar to chicken and has earned Dixie a spot on New Times’ list of “Six Best Restaurants Serving Alligator in South Florida.”

House-Brewed Beer Selection: Head brewer Jason Matta creates about a dozen unique beers that you won’t find anywhere else, from Hakuna Wheatata Wheat Ale to Don’t Copy That Hoppy Imperial IPA, plus his signature Ambrocious Amber Ale – his take on a “Florida Fat Tire.” With 30 craft beers on tap total, the selection constantly rotates to feature both house brews and special releases from other breweries.

Atmosphere & Décor

Vintage Collectible Paradise: The interior showcases over 50 years of collected antiques, from pedal cars to vintage Florida paintings, with guitars, tin lunch boxes, and humorous wooden signs covering every available surface, including the bathrooms.

The ceiling overflows with guitars, sneakers, kitschy lunch boxes and other vintage curiosities, while even retired beer taps keep a home behind the bar. It’s the kind of place where you could spend hours just examining all the fascinating memorabilia.

Indoor and Outdoor Seating: You can choose between the intimate indoor setting with its cozy booths and unique décor, or the covered outdoor patio that’s popular year-round.

The hunting lodge ambiance creates a down-to-earth atmosphere that’s both relaxing and entertaining. During peak season, especially Friday and Saturday nights, this relatively small space fills up quickly with both locals and visitors.

Family and Pet-Friendly Environment: The setup is family-friendly with great food options for kids, and dogs are welcome too, making it a perfect neighborhood gathering spot. They even offer a kids’ menu and a dog menu, ensuring every member of the family is taken care of.

Other Considerations

Reasonable Pricing for Quality: The pricing is great for the quality you receive, with an informal menu that matches the relaxed atmosphere while delivering food that’s clearly been mastered by an experienced kitchen team. You can expect to spend around $30 per person for a full meal including tax and tip, which represents solid value for the portion sizes and quality.

Convenient Location with Parking Challenges: Located directly on busy Dixie Highway, the restaurant sits in a revitalized urban neighborhood near Antique Row, with about 5-6 dedicated parking spots plus street parking available. While the parking lot is small, most visitors find spots if they arrive before the dinner rush.

Weekly Entertainment: Think & Drink Trivia happens on Friday nights at 9pm on the patio and it’s always free to play, drawing a regular crowd of locals.

They also host special events like Paint and Pint nights, creating a lively community atmosphere. Monday features $1 off half-pound burgers after 5pm, while Wednesday offers $1 off any of their 30 craft brews from 3-10pm.

Take-Home Options: Crowlers are available to take home, so you can enjoy their house-brewed beers later. This is perfect for beer enthusiasts who want to savor those unique brews that aren’t available anywhere else.
